This is a Phase 1, open-label, three-period sequential dosing study being conducted primarily to determine the pharmacokinetics of Triferic iron administered intravenously to healthy adults.. Participation will be up to 5 weeks total duration including Screening, Baseline, Treatment Period, and Follow-up. Following Screening, subjects will be admitted to the clinic on Day -1, prior to Baseline (Day 1). During the Treatment Period, subjects will receive two doses of Triferic. Each subject will receive a single 6-mg dose of Triferic administered IV over 3 hours (hr) on one day (Day 2), and a single 35-µg/kg dose of Triferic administered IV push the following day (Day 3). On Day 4, subjects will be discharged from the clinic and will return approximately one week later for their final Follow-up visit.

Triferic is supplied as sterile 5 mL ampules containing 5.44 mg/mL of iron in water for injection. Each 5 mL ampule contains 27.2 mg of Triferic iron.

Pharmacokinetics of Triferic Iron Administered IV to Healthy Adults: Maximum Drug Concentration (Cmax) of Total Serum Iron
Blood samples will be drawn at time = 0, 1, 2, 3, 3.5, 4, 4.5, 5, 6, 8, 12, and 16 hours after the start of Triferic administration on study Day 2 (IV infusion of 6 mg Triferic over 3 hours) and Day 3 (35 microgram/kg IV dose of Triferic given over 30 - 60 seconds) in order to determine the Peak Serum Concentration, corrected (Cmax) of total serum iron.
Time frame: 16 hours
Pharmacokinetics of Triferic Iron Administered IV to Healthy Adults: Area Under the Serum Iron Concentration Time Curve From Time Zero to the Time of Last Quantified Concentration (AUC(Last)) of Total Serum Iron
Blood samples will be drawn at time = 0, 1, 2, 3, 3.5, 4, 4.5, 5, 6, 8, 12, and 16 hours after the start of Triferic administration on study Day 2 (IV infusion of 6 mg Triferic over 3 hours) and study day 3 (35 microgram/kg IV Triferic dose administered in 30 - 60 seconds) in order to determine the AUC(last) of total serum iron.
Time frame: 16 hours
